Application of Wave Impedance Inversion Research ofPermian Reservoir in the Slope Area of Chenghai

Abstract

The geological conditions are complex in the Permian slope area of Chenghai in Dagang Oilfield,and the reservoir thickness varies in physical properties.It is difficult to find out the reservoir characteristics and distribution rules by using a single conventional inversion method.Therefore,we integrate the technologies of the sampling sites data statistics and a variety of seismic attributes on the basis of logging constrained inversion for the Permian strata after the fine interpretation of the re-processing singularity 3-D pre-stack time migration data of buried hill in Chenghai.After we complete reservoir prediction of the three Permian sand groups,the reliability of reservoir identification and inverse predictions are significantly improved.As a core technology of reservoir prediction,wave impedance inversion which predicts the distribution and thickness of the sand body by combining sampling sites data statistics and multiple attribute data plays an important role and gets significant geological effects in the exploration of the subtle reservoir in the slope area of Chenghai.
